Eva Mendes has publicly refuted claims that she and her partner, Ryan Gosling, have relocated to London. The rumors, initially reported by the Daily Mail, suggested that the couple had purchased a home in North London and enrolled their daughters in local
schools. Mendes addressed these rumors on Instagram, expressing her eagerness to return to the U.S. and celebrate the Los Angeles Dodgers' World Series victory. Mendes has been open about her departure from Hollywood, citing dissatisfaction with the roles offered to her and the lifestyle associated with the industry. Despite this, she remains open to future acting opportunities, particularly if they involve working with Gosling.
